Support the coordination and delivery of UK Ops. Support the development of all UK Ops CONPLANs and HQ Staff Work. Conduct multi-agency liaison with cross-government resilience partners. Understand and disseminate UK Ops policy and doctrine.
Operational Support: Watch keeping, Operations Room Delivery, Operational Record Keeping and information management tasks. Desk level liaison with RC UK Ops and HQ SJC (UK). Conduct a minimum of 2 days UK Ops Trg and support the JMC during Ops delivery and Ex CAMBRIAN PATROL. Other relevant and appropriate tasks and duties as directed.
